Amanda Bynes' Twitter Account Deleted

Amanda Bynes' on-and-off relationship with Twitter appears to have reached a low point.

The Twitter account @chicky, which the actress famously used to overshare and rant about her personal and professional life, has been deleted.

Bynes, who has sent out childhood pics and declared her very specific taste in men on her Twitter page, famously tweeted her retirement from Hollywood in June.

"I don't love acting anymore, so I've stopped doing it," the starlet wrote at the time. "I know 24 is a young age to retire but you heard it here first I've #retired."

Bynes' announcement came as a shock to her rep, who was blindsided by the news after speaking to her client days earlier and noting she "sounded great."
However, the actress had a change of heart and took to her Twitter page about a month later to reveal she was back on the scene, writing, "I've unretired."

This latest move could be related to a desire Bynes' once expressed about keeping a safe distance from the sometimes harsh glare of the spotlight.

"I don't want to have my face on everything. I just don't want to be some young brat who is everywhere," a then-18-year-old Bynes told MTV News in 2005. "It sickens me."

The young actress also copped to not always being on the same page as her Hollywood peers.

"I don't really relate to that many people who are my age, especially in this business."

Fans may not be getting updates about her fluctuating retirement status anymore, but moviegoers will be able to catch Bynes in the upcoming flick "Easy A." The actress plays a judgmental teen out to ruin the life of a faux good-time girl in the high school comedy, which hits theaters September 17.

Amanda Bynes to create animal circus show in Las Vegas?

“It’s Viva Las Vegas for Amanda Bynes,” reads the headline of a National Enquirer story, which, in all earnestness, goes on to claim that she’s “running away to join the circus!”

The tab reports that Bynes, who recently announced her retirement from acting, “is planning an animal-themed show in Las Vegas.”

Yes, you read that right.

According to a so-called “pal” quoted in the article, “Amanda loves animals… and she’s looking into doing a circus-type animal show in Vegas while her name is still hot.”

Really?
No.

A rep for Bynes called the report “hilarious,” and a source close to the former “All That” star tells Gossip Cop there isn’t a shred of truth to it.

Once again, the only clowns here are the ones at the Enquirer.

Amanda Bynes In Easy

What I Like about You star Amanda Bynes in Easy A? Get the details here on Bynes’ new movie with photos and videos after the jump. Trading in her normal role as the girl next door, Actress Amanda Bynes is currently finishing up on the set of ‘Easy A’ as the character Marianne, a bossy and controlling preacher of abstinence.
In the movie Bynes plays opposite her on screen co-star Emma Stone whose character’s reputation she decides to sabotage with rumors regarding her virginity. Instead of falling into the trap that is high school Stone’s character Olive makes the news around school work to her advantage.

Directed by Will Gluck and written by Bert V. Royal, Easy A will feature a line up of stars such as Gossip Girls’ Penn Badgley, Cam Gigandet, actor Stanley Tucci, Malcolm McDowell and Alyson Michalka, the other half of the popular duo Ally and AJ.

Bynes has recently been seen in the 2009 production off Canned as the character Sarabeth and 2008’s Living Proof in the role of Jamie.
